MODEL COOPERATIVE SCRIPT BERPENDEKATAN SCIENCE, ENVIRONMENT, TECHNOLOGY, AND SOCIETY (SETS) TERHADAP HASIL BELAJAR Maksum, Amir; Maksum, Amir
Jurnal Inovasi Pendidikan Kimia Vol 7, No 1 (2013): January 2013
Publisher : Jurusan Kimia, Fakultas Matematika dan Ilmu Pengetahuan Alam, Universitas Negeri Semarang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

This study aimed to determine the positive effects of the applicatioan of learning model by using script cooperative with SETS approach to chemistry students learning outcomes of student in class X. The population in this study is students class X high school in Kendal. Sampling is done by cluster purposive sampling technique, obtained one class as a experiment class that uses of script cooperative learning with the model SETS approach and another class as the gain control class with expository teaching using SETS approach. Data were collected by using documentation method, testing, observation and questionnaires. Based on the analysis of  affective domain data, it gained score percentage of 80% for the experimental class and 78% for   control class. While the score percentage for the psychomotor domain data acquired 79% of the experimental class and 78% the control class. Based on the analysis of the results, obtained correlation coefficient r b 0.52 with the contribution of 28%. The conclusions in this study is the use of script cooperative learning with the model SETS approach have an effects on the the learning outcomes of chemistry class X of high school students in Kendal on the subject redox concept with contributions of 28%.

PENGARUH MODEL TEAM GAMES TOURNAMENT MEDIA TOURNAMENTQUESTION CARDS TERHADAP HASIL BELAJAR SISWA PADA MATERI HIDROKARBON Sari, Armynda Dewi Cita; Supardi, Kasmadi Imam
Jurnal Inovasi Pendidikan Kimia Vol 7, No 2 (2013): July 2013
Publisher : Jurusan Kimia, Fakultas Matematika dan Ilmu Pengetahuan Alam, Universitas Negeri Semarang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

This study was conducted to find out the effect of Team Games Tournament teaching model using Tournament-Question Cards, toward the learning outcomes of a Senior High School (SHS) in Semarang on hydrocarbon and crude oil subjects. The initial observation result showed that their learning outcomes was still low as 55,78%. The population was X grader of a SHS in Semarang for the academic years 2011/2012. The sample was X-3 grader students as the control and X-4 grader as the experimental, which were selected using cluster random sampling method. Team Games Tournament teaching model using Tournament-Question Cards were applied in the  experimental class, while the conventional teaching model were used in the control class. Based on the facts, the average of post test result from the experiment class was 83,96 and the control class was 75,56. The experiment class and the control class post test grades were distributed normally and had the same variants, whereas on the one-sample t-test result was t count (3,61) > t table (2,02)  which mean the average grade of experiment was better than the control class. Hypothesis testing used were biserial correlation coefficient and coefficient of determination obtained rb =0,618 and the influence 38,15%. It can be concluded that there is a significant correlation between Team Games Tournament teaching model using Tournament-Question Cards toward the learning outcomes of X grader of SHS in Semarang on hydrocarbon and crude oil subjects, with influence 38,15%.Key Words: Tournament-Question Cards media 
PENGEMBANGAN INSTRUMEN PENILAIAN KETERAMPILAN BERPIKIR KRITIS SISWA SMA PADA MATERI ASAM BASA Amalia, Nunung Fika; Susilaningsih, Endang
Jurnal Inovasi Pendidikan Kimia Vol 8, No 2 (2014): July 2014
Publisher : Jurusan Kimia, Fakultas Matematika dan Ilmu Pengetahuan Alam, Universitas Negeri Semarang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

In order to achieve the national education goals, students are required to have critical thinking skills, especially on abstract lesson such as chemistry. Preliminary research conducted at one of high school in Ambarawa found that the assessment instruments used have not been oriented toward critical thinking skills. The purpose of this study is to investigate the process of developing critical thinking skills assessment instruments, to obtain the innovation critical thinking skills assessment instruments that can measure students critical thinking skills, and acquire critical thinking skills assessment instruments that meet criteria for valid and reliable. The research is a Research and Development. The procedures are the preliminary stages of research and development stages. Preliminary stages are divided into two, namely the field studies and literature studies. The development stages are divided into several parts, namely 1) develop the type of instrument, 2) validation by expert, 3) a limited scale trial, 4) large-scale trials and 5) implementation of the product. The results of this study indicate that the type of instrument used in schools have cognitive taxonomic level C1 to C2 and sometimes C3. Assessment instruments developed was essay test analysis, student activity sheets, and testoriented problem solving students critical thinking skills. Assessment instruments that have been developed in this study is valid and reliable and positive effect on students cognitive learning outcomes. Keywords: Assessment Instruments, Critical Thinking Skills, Acid-Base Materials

KEEFEKTIFAN PEMBELAJARAN BERORIENTASI CHEMOENTREPRENEURSHIP PADA PEMAHAMAN KONSEP DAN KEMAMPUAN LIFE SKILL SISWA Nurmasari, Novita; -, Supartono; Sedyawati, Sri Mantini Rahayu
Jurnal Inovasi Pendidikan Kimia Vol 8, No 1 (2014): January 2014
Publisher : Jurusan Kimia, Fakultas Matematika dan Ilmu Pengetahuan Alam, Universitas Negeri Semarang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

Preliminary study has performed in a high school in Semarang within grade X of the school year 2012/2013, obtained the classical completeness students on chemistry subject less than 85% and the ability of students life skill was lower, equal to 61%. This study applied the learning-oriented Chemoentrepreneurship (CEP) in petroleum subject. This study aimed to determine the effectiveness of the learning-oriented CEP in understanding the concepts and life skills of high school students’ grade X. The population in this study were class X students of high school in Semarang. The design used is a posttest only control design. The sample was taken by random cluster sampling technique, the class X-3 as the experimental class and the class X-2 as a control class. The results of completeness study showed that experimental class achieved mastery of classical study at 88.89%, while the control class was only 78.95%. The average of students’ concept understanding in experimental class was better than the control class respectively 80.11 and 74.32. The ability of student life skill increased from 61% to 84. The results showed that the learning-oriented CEP provided significant effectiveness in understanding the concepts and life skills of class X high school students.Keywords: Chemoentrepreneurship, Concept Understands, Life Skill

LABORATORIUM KIMIA VIRTUAL: ALTERNATIF PEMBELAJARAN KIMIA UNTUK MENINGKATKAN HASIL BELAJAR MAHASISWA TADRIS KIMIA IAIN WALISONGO SEMARANG -, Mulyatun
Jurnal Inovasi Pendidikan Kimia Vol 7, No 1 (2013): January 2013
Publisher : Jurusan Kimia, Fakultas Matematika dan Ilmu Pengetahuan Alam, Universitas Negeri Semarang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

The objectives of this study were to describe the efectiveness of using virtual chemistry laboratory to improve the chemistry students’ learning. The subjects of this study were the students at grade I of Tadris Kimia IAIN Walisongo Semarang in the academic year of 2011/2012.The subjects was 40 students. The research uses cluster random sampling technique. Class TK-IA is chosen as experimental class (the students who are taught using virtual chemistry laboratory), and class TK-IB is chosen as control class (the students who are not taught using virtual chemistry laboratory). The result showed that the average score for eksperimental class is 31,4 for the pre test and 74,4 for the post test. While the average for control class is 31,6 for the  pre test and 62,2 for the post test. The calculation using the t-test showed the value of the t-test is higher than the value of the t-table.the value of t-test is 4,332 while the value oft-table on alpha 5% is 2,02 (4,332>2,02). It can be concluded that there is a significant difference in student’s learning between students who are taught using virtual chemistry laboratory than students who are not taught without it. So, we can conclude that using virtual chemistry laboratory is effective to improve the chemistry students’ learning.
